Mechanical Vs. Battery Powered
Among watch aficionados, mechanical watches-that use conventional clockwork technology-carry extra clout. Guide-winding watches should be wound each day, which requires effort from the wearer, as properly as the potential monetary investment in a watch winder. The advantage of a battery-powered quartz movement is that the wearer doesn’t have to do a lot aside from change the watch battery.


Complications
A complication on a watch is anything apart from the show of time as seconds, minutes and hours. Usually, a complication is one thing exhibited to make your life easier-such as a date window, dual time zones, moon phases or a perpetual calendar. Case Measurement
To get an concept of what case measurement works finest in your wrist, do an in-individual strive on session earlier than buying. Some might look too bulky, while others will appear skimpy and get lost on your wrist. Watch instances come in quite a lot of shapes-the more fundamental are round, oval, square or rectangular-and they’re sometimes listed in millimeters. They often vary from about 24mm to 38mm for women and 38mm and 56mm for males, but this is totally dependent on private desire. “Trends in watch case sizes are kind of like tendencies in jeans-they modify all the time,” says Gordon. “A 30mm case is pretty customary for a woman, and 38 to 42mm is pretty standard for a man.”

However, it’s ultimately up to you to determine what you want finest. “Watches should be judged by their measurement and not the intercourse they’re marketed for,” says Yoch. “If you fall in love with one thing that’s not a typical or conventional measurement, overlook whether or not the label says it’s men’s or ladies's. Purchase what you want.”


Strap
Straps come in a wide range of supplies, together with leather, metal (also known as a bracelet), fabric and rubber. There are basically two varieties of straps: these which can be a continuous and connected to the watch case, and people that are interchangeable or replaceable. “An integral strap or bracelet cannot be removed and is difficult to restore,” says Gordon. “With most watches, like Rolexes, the strap or bracelet comes off and could be modified.” Usually, bands vary in size from six to eight inches and are usually about half the width of the watch case.

Are Mechanical Or Battery Powered Watches Better?
Each are good choices, but they’re considerably different. “It’s really a matter of opinion,” says Gordon. “Quartz-or battery powered-timepieces are more accurate, but you will have to change the battery and many individuals don’t like to try this. People with automatic watches respect the mechanisms and how intricately they’re constructed.” Mechanical watches are usually far more expensive.

Guide and automated watches are each mechanical. “Manual movements should be wound every day,” says Gordon. “Automatic movements are self-winding, so you don’t have to do that because the watch winds itself whilst you wear it on your wrist.” If, nevertheless, you don’t wear your automatic watch for a couple days it'll cease, so you’ll must wind it manually. A quartz motion is battery powered so doesn’t require winding.
